The painting "St. Giles" was created by Jan Kanty Danielski, a Cracovian painter (born in 1785 or 1787, deceased in 1831). Originally, the painting was hanging near the high altar. Currently it is located in the side altar. The painting shows Saint Giles, patron of the church in Giebułtów since the 11th century.
